Who is Nidhi Tewari? Newly Appointed PM Modi Private Secretary; Check Salary, Roles and Responsibilities

Indian Foreign Officials (IFS) official Nidhi Tewari has been appointed as the private secretary of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, the Ministry of Personnel announced in an order on Sunday.

The Department of Personnel and Training (DOPT) formally announced the nomination, which was approved by the Cabinet Appointment Committee.

Who is Nidhi Tewari?

Nidhi Tewari is an Indian Foreign Force (IFS) official from the Mahmoorganj community in Varanasi. She finished 96th in the Civil Service Examination in 2013 and initially served as an assistant commissioner in Varanasi before joining Foreign Service in India.

The role of Nidhi Tewari in the Prime Minister’s Office (PMO)

Tewari began serving as secretary in the Prime Minister’s Office (PMO) in 2022. On January 6, 2023, she was promoted to deputy secretary. She plays a key role in the “Foreign and Security” sector and reports directly to National Security Adviser Ajit Doval.

Nidhi Tewari’s contribution to MEA

Prior to joining the PMO, Nidhi worked for the Ministry of Disarmament and International Security Affairs of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
